Understanding Your Financial Situation
Before offering advice, a financial advisor will first review your current financial situation. Understanding your current income, debt, and expenditures is critical in determining potential options for debt management. A financial advisor will help identify any bad spending habits and provide a plan to redirect funds to pay off debt. An advisor will also review your credit score and advise on how to make improvements.
Customised Debt Reduction Plan
An experienced financial advisor will help create a tailored plan to pay off your debt while still maintaining your lifestyle. A financial advisor will provide advice on debt consolidation, consolidating your debt into one payment to lower interest rates. Consolidation reduces the monthly payment, making it easier to pay off the debt. Additionally, an advisor will provide guidance on creating a budget, cutting back on expenses and increasing income where possible, allowing more money to be directed towards debt reduction.

Improved Credit Score
Debt is tied directly to your credit score, which influences your future credit opportunities such as loans, credit cards, and mortgages. Reducing your debt can significantly improve your credit score, and an advisor can create a plan to help you achieve that. Financial advisors can give counsel on how to negotiate with creditors to pay off debt faster. An improved credit score will create better financial opportunities.
